Venable LLP is pleased to announce the arrival of Joshua Rosenberg, partner, and Max Wellman, counsel, at the firm’s Litigation Practice in the Los Angeles office.
Mr. Rosenberg handles a wide range of complex litigation matters, including breach of contract, copyright and trademark infringement, employment disputes, defamation, invasion of privacy, and general business matters. He has represented numerous entertainment industry clients, including studios, production companies, talent agencies, management companies, concert promoters, record labels, recording artists, actors, writers, directors, producers, studio executives, and social media influencers. He has also represented manufacturers, real estate developers, high-net-worth individuals, and nonprofit organizations.
Mr. Wellman represents individual and corporate clients in business and entertainment matters. He works closely with his clients to build relationships and manage their needs, both in and outside of the courtroom. When handling litigation, Mr. Wellman focuses on complex commercial disputes involving intellectual property, trade secrets, commercial debts, corporate dissolutions, and general contract and business tort claims. Outside the courtroom, Mr. Wellman provides strategic and operational advice, primarily in the entertainment, media, and technology industries, including assisting intellectual property owners in building, protecting, and monetizing their assets. He predominantly represents production companies, global influencers, merchandising companies, developing artists, entrepreneurs, consumer product brands, and technology start-ups.
